Sweden - Total Health Expenditures

Since 2014, Sweden Total Health Expenditures was up 3.5% year on year. With $5,782.29 Per Capita in 2019, the country was ranked number 6 among other countries in Total Health Expenditures. Sweden is overtaken by Austria, which was number 5 with $5,851.06 Per Capita and is followed by Netherlands at $5,765.1 Per Capita. United States ranked the highest with $11,071.72 Per Capita in 2019, an increase of 4.1% versus 2018. Switzerland, Norway and Germany resp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Romania witnessed the best average annual growth at +12.7% per year, while South Africa witnessed the worst performance at +1.9% per year.
